I'm not sure if they are working with/without sgmii (1000base-X) and if they have builtin phy. Fiber SFPs do not have a built in PHY. They merely convert the serdes electrical waveform into light and back again, possibly with some retiming of the received waveform, and a bit of monitoring. They're pretty simple devices.
